﻿<!--

	var LIP = '';
	var tmt = document; 
	var tmtDomain = tmt.location
	var strRefererTotal = tmt.referrer; //참조했던 페이지
	var strBrowser;
	var strOs;
	var strSearchKeyWord; //유입검색어()

	var _tmtPID = ''; //사이트 구분자

	var _tmtSS = new Array();
	var _tmtSK = new Array();
	var _tmtIEN = new Array();
	_tmtSS[0]="search.daum.net";	_tmtSK[0]="q"; _tmtIEN[0] = 0;
	_tmtSS[1]="naver.com";	_tmtSK[1]="query"; _tmtIEN[1] = 0;
	_tmtSS[2]="search.yahoo.com";		_tmtSK[2]="p"; _tmtIEN[2] = 0;
	_tmtSS[3]="search.empas.com";		_tmtSK[3]="q"; _tmtIEN[3] = 0;
	_tmtSS[4]="lycos.co.kr";	_tmtSK[4]="q"; _tmtIEN[4] = 0;
	_tmtSS[5]="search.lycos.com";		_tmtSK[5]="query"; _tmtIEN[5] = 0;
	_tmtSS[6]="search.paran.com";	_tmtSK[6]="Query"; _tmtIEN[6] = 0;
	_tmtSS[7]="searchplus.nate.com";	_tmtSK[7]="q"; _tmtIEN[7] = 0;
	_tmtSS[8]="search.msn";	_tmtSK[8]="q"; _tmtIEN[8] = 1;
	_tmtSS[9]="google";	_tmtSK[9]="q"; _tmtIEN[9] = 1;
	_tmtSS[10]="search.allblog.net";	_tmtSK[10]="k"; _tmtIEN[10] = 1;


	if(tmtDomain.protocol == 'http:' || tmtDomain.protocol == 'https:') {
		strReferer = tmtDomain.hostname;
	}else{
		strReferer = '';
	}
	


	function _tmtCatch(){
		strRefererTotal = strRefererTotal.toLowerCase(); 
		strReferer_Page = tmtDomain.pathname //현재 페이지명

		strOs = _tmtO(); //OS 확인
		strBrowser = _tmtB(); //브라우저 확인

		if (_tmtNULL(strRefererTotal) == 1) { strRefererTotal="-"; }
		var strSearch;
		strSearch = _tmtR(); //search.naver.com|%25c5%25e4%25b8%25e0%25c5%25e4

		//strSearch				--검색사이트
		//strReferer_Page		--현재페이지명
		//strBrowser				--브라우저
		//strOs						--OS

        var objValue = new Object();
        
        objValue.strReferer_Page = strReferer_Page;
        objValue.Browser = strBrowser;
        objValue.strOs = strOs;
        
        CVS.Service.SiteAccessLogService.User_Access_Save(objValue);
	}
    
	function _tmtIN(s,t){
		if( _tmtNULL(s) == 1) return false;
		if(s.indexOf(t) >-1)
			return true;
		else
			return false;
	}


	function _tmtO(){
		var n = navigator,to="Other",tv="-",o=to;
		if (n.platform) {to = n.platform.toLowerCase();}
		if (n.appVersion) {tv = n.userAgent.toLowerCase();}
		if( _tmtIN(to,'win32')){
			if( _tmtIN(tv,'98')){ o = '11202';}                                                        //Windows 98
			else if( _tmtIN(tv,'nt 5.0')){o = '11203';}                       //Windows 2000
			else if( _tmtIN(tv,'nt 5.1')){o = '11204';}                          //Windows XP
			else if( _tmtIN(tv,'nt 5.2')){o ='11205';}             //Windows Server 2003
			else if( _tmtIN(tv,'nt 6.0')){o ='11206';}		                 //Windows Vista   
			else if( _tmtIN(tv,'nt 6.1')){o ='11207';}		                        //Windows 7   
			else if( _tmtIN(tv,'nt')){ o = '11208';}                              //Windows NT
			else{ o = '11201';}                                                                             //Windows
		}else{
			var st = to.substring(0,4);
			if( st == 'win1'){o = '11209';}                                      //Windows 3.1
			else if( st == 'mac6' ){ o = '11210';}                                          //Mac           
			else if( st == 'maco' ){ o ='11210';}                                           //Mac
			else if( st == 'macp' ){o='11210';}                                             //Mac
			else if( st == 'linu'){o='11211';}                                               //Linux
			else if( st == 'webt' ){ o='11212';}                                        //WebTV
			else if( st =='osf1' ){ o ='11213';}                     //Compaq Open VMS
			else if( st == 'hp-u' ){ o='11214';}                                       //HP Unix
			else if( st == 'os/2' ){ o = '11215' ;}                                         //OS/2
			else if( st == 'aix4' ){ o = '11216';}                                             //AIX
			else if( st == 'free' ){ o = '11217';}                                      //FreeBSD
			else if( st == 'suno' ){ o = '11218';}                                         //SunO
			else if( st == 'drea' ){ o = '11219'; }                                          //Drea
			else if( st == 'plan' ){ o = '11220'; }                                           //Plan
		}
		return o;
	}

	function _tmtB(){
		var n = navigator,tb="Other",b=tb;
		if (n.userAgent) {tb = navigator.userAgent.toLowerCase();}
		if (_tmtIN(tb,'msie')) {
			if(_tmtIN(tb,'msie 6.0')) { b = "11302";}                      //Microsoft Internet Explorer 6.0
			else if(_tmtIN(tb,'msie 7.0')) { b = "11303";}               //Microsoft Internet Explorer 7.0
			else if(_tmtIN(tb,'msie 8.0')) { b = "11304";}               //Microsoft Internet Explorer 8.0
			else{ b = "11301";}
		}
		else if(_tmtIN(tb,'opera')) { b = "11305"; }                 //Opera
		else if(_tmtIN(tb,'netscape')) { b = "11306"; }       //Netscape
		else if(_tmtIN(tb,'firefox/2')) { b = "11307"; }         //Firefox2
		else if(_tmtIN(tb,'firefox')) { b = "11308"; }              //Firefox    
		else if(_tmtIN(tb,'safari')) { b = "11309"; }	                //Safari
		return b; 
	}


	function _tmtR() {
		var i=0,h,q="",u="",it="",p="";
		if ((i=strRefererTotal.indexOf("://")) < 0) return "|";
		h=strRefererTotal.substring(i+3,strRefererTotal.length);
		if ((i = h.indexOf("/")) > -1) {
			u=h.substring(i,h.length);
			h=h.substring(0,i);
			it = "s";
		}
		if( (i = u.indexOf("?")) > -1){
			p = u;
			u=u.substring(0,i);
			p=p.substring(i,p.length);
		}


		for (var ii=0;ii<_tmtSS.length;ii++) {
			if (h.toLowerCase().indexOf(_tmtSS[ii]) > -1) {
				if ((i=strRefererTotal.indexOf("?"+_tmtSK[ii]+"=")) > -1 || (i=strRefererTotal.indexOf("&"+_tmtSK[ii]+"=")) > -1) {
					q=strRefererTotal.substring(i+_tmtSK[ii].length+2,strRefererTotal.length);
					if ((i=q.indexOf("&")) > -1) q=q.substring(0,i);
					if(_tmtIEN[ii] == 1){q = _tmtUEN(q);}
				}
			}
		}
		if(q!="-") it = "e"; else it="s";
		if(it == "e" && _tmtIN(h,"naver.com")){
			if(_tmtIN(q,"%u")){
				q = unescape(q);
			}
		}

		//return it+"|"+_tmtEN(h)+"|"+_tmtEN(u)+"|"+_tmtEN(p)+"|"+_tmtEN(q);
		return _tmtEN(h)+"|"+_tmtEN(q);
	}




	function _tmtEN(s) {
		s = s.replace("|","").replace("%7C","");
		return escape(s).replace(/\+/g, '%2B');
		//return unescape(s);
	}

	function _tmtNULL(s){
		if(!s || s == "" || s == "undefined" || s =="unknown"){
			return 1;
		}else{
			return 0;
		}
	}




	function tmtGC(Name) { 
	  var search = Name + "="
	  var returnvalue = "";
	  if (document.cookie.length > 0) {
		offset = document.cookie.indexOf(search)

		if (offset != -1) { 
		  offset += search.length
		  end = document.cookie.indexOf(";", offset);
		  if (end == -1) end = document.cookie.length;
		  returnvalue=unescape(document.cookie.substring(offset, end))
		}
	  }
	  return returnvalue;
	}

	function _tmtOnLD() {

	  var cookiename = window.location.pathname

	  var flag = eval(tmtGC(window.location.pathname));
	  if(_tmtNULL(flag) == 1) {
		var cookievalue = "true";
		document.cookie= cookiename+"="+cookievalue;
		_tmtCatch();

	  }
	}
	//_tmtOnLD();
//-->